Mastering Roll Anime to Fight Controls and Interface
Navigating the battle arena and managing your roster efficiently requires a complete understanding of the interface. This Roblox simulator, developed by Another Slop (Place ID: 107653945083776), relies on a mix of standard mouse clicks, menu toggles, and placement mechanics. Knowing where to click and how to hotkey your menus saves valuable seconds between wave spawns.

The table below outlines the primary interactive elements on your screen and their exact functions.
| Control Element | Screen Location | Primary Function | Interaction Type |
|---|---|---|---|
| Roll Button | Bottom Center | Spend currency to summon new anime fighters | Click / Tap |
| Team Menu | Left Sidebar | Equip, unequip, lock, and view fighter stats | Toggle Click |
| Merge Interface | Left Sidebar | Combine duplicate units to increase levels | Toggle Click |
| Codes Menu | Left Sidebar | Input promotional codes for rewards | Text Input |
| Wave Start | Right Center | Trigger the next wave of incoming enemies | Proximity / Click |
Always lock your Mythic, Legendary, and mutated fighters as soon as you roll them. The lock toggle in the Team Menu prevents you from accidentally using highly valuable units as merge fodder.
Fighter Selection and Combat Mechanics
Your combat success in roll anime to fight controls depends heavily on how you evaluate and deploy your team. Rarity is only one part of the equation; you must also analyze damage per second (DPS), attack range (RNG), and attack cooldowns (CD) to build a balanced lineup.

Use this quick comparison table to understand how different stats impact your combat performance during active waves.
| Stat Type | Priority Level | Combat Benefit | Recommended Threshold |
|---|---|---|---|
| DPS | Critical | Determines overall damage output | Maximize on boss killers |
| Range (RNG) | High | Allows units to strike from safety | Moderate to high for AoE |
| Cooldown (CD) | Medium | Keeps attack animations fast and fluid | Below 2.0s for speed units |
Do not fill your active team with slow-attacking, high-damage units. A wave of fast-moving, low-health enemies can easily slip past your defense if your units have long attack cooldowns.
Step-by-Step Team Progression Route
To advance smoothly from your very first roll to high-wave checkpoints, follow this structured setup and upgrade path.
Fill Your Active Roster
Roll your first set of fighters and equip them immediately. Ensure every available team slot is filled before you begin merging or filtering units.
Identify Mutation Branches
Check your rolled units for special mutation labels such as Gold, Diamond, Nen, or Titan. Keep these mutated variants separate from standard units.
Merge Standard Duplicates
Open the Merge Menu, select your primary active fighter, and feed identical standard duplicates into it to boost its level and raw damage.
Push to the Next Checkpoint
Enter the endless waves and fight until you reach a new checkpoint milestone. Reinvest your milestone rewards back into the rolling system.
A fully merged Legendary or high-value mutated Epic unit can easily outperform a base, unmerged Mythic unit. Always compare active combat stats rather than relying solely on rarity colors.
Mutation Priority and Roster Management
Mutations are rare variants that significantly alter a fighter's base stats and visual design. Understanding which mutations to keep and which ones to merge is vital for late-game progression.
| Mutation | Tier | Keep Priority | Best Combat Role | Upgrade Strategy |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Nen | S | Highest | Core DPS / Boss Killer | Build dedicated Nen merge line |
| Titan | S | Highest | High-Wave Progression | Save duplicate Titan copies |
| Diamond | A | High | Damage Booster | Merge only within Diamond line |
| Gold | B | Moderate | Mid-Game Progression | Use as primary mid-game carry |
| None | C | Low | Merge Material | Feed to active mutated units |

Endless Waves Checkpoints and Rewards
The progression loop rewards players who consistently push their limits. Checkpoints serve as permanent safety nets, allowing you to bypass early waves and farm high-tier resources directly.
| Stage Name | Checkpoint Goal | Recommended Team Strength | Milestone Reward Use |
|---|---|---|---|
| Starting Waves | Wave 10 | Complete base team | Roll for initial duplicates |
| First Stable Run | Wave 25 | Level 5+ standard units | Merge active team members |
| Checkpoint Push | Wave 50 | Leveled Legendaries | Target rare mutations |
| High-Wave Progression | Wave 100+ | Mutated Mythics (Nen/Titan) | Maximize high-tier stats |
Reaching a milestone unlocks permanent bonuses and increases your passive currency generation. If you hit a wall, do not keep retrying immediately; spend your current earnings on rolls and merges first.
Q: How do I access the roll anime to fight controls on mobile devices?
The mobile interface uses touch-screen buttons located on the left and bottom of the screen. Tap the sidebar icons to open the Team and Merge menus, and tap the center button to roll.
Q: Can I undo a merge if I accidentally select the wrong unit?
No, merges are permanent and cannot be undone. To prevent accidental merges, always use the 'Lock' feature in your Team Menu on all high-rarity and mutated units.
Q: What is the best mutation to target for high wave counts?
Nen and Titan are the top-tier mutations. They provide massive combat multipliers that remain highly effective even when enemy health scales drastically in later waves.
